Authorities agree that the dog was the first of man’s domesticated animals. How and when this domestication took place, however, remains unknown. A 50,000-year-old cave painting in Europe seems to show a doglike animal hunting with men. But most experts believe the dog was domesticated only within the last 15,000 years. Moreover, fossil remains that would substantiate the presence of dogs with humans have not yet been unearthed for periods earlier than about 10,000 BC.
One theory holds that humans took wolf pups back to their camp or cave, reared them, allowed the tame wolves to hunt with them, and later accepted pups of the tame wolves into the family circle. Another theory suggests that dogs were attracted to food scraps dumped as waste near human living sites. As they ate them up and kept the site clean, the dogs offered a service to the humans. In turn, the humans would accept the presence of the dogs and would not drive them away.

权威部门认为,狗是第一种被人类驯养的动物。然而,如何以及何时开始驯养一直不为人知。在欧洲5万年前的洞穴壁画上似乎显示有类似狗的动物和人们一起狩猎。但专家们大多认为,狗的驯养只是在1.5万年前才开始的。另外,迄今为止尚未发现早于约公元前1万年的能证实狗和人在一起的化石。 有一种理论认为,人把狼崽带回他们的营地或洞穴饲养,并带着驯化的狼一起狩猎,以后就接纳驯化的狼崽进入了人类的家庭圈子。还有一种理论认为,狗被人类住地附近倾倒的残羹剩饭所吸引。由于狗能清除那些垃圾,保持住地干净,从而给人们提供了服务。因此,人们就接纳了这些狗,不愿把它们赶走。
